PIC12C508A-04/P Microchip Integrated Circuit (Dual-In-Line Packages) In Stock

The Microchip PIC12C508A-04/P is an 8-bit CMOS microcontroller in the PIC12 family running at up to 4 MHz with 512 words of OTP program memory and 25 bytes of RAM in a compact 8-pin DIP package. It offers 6 I/O pins and an on-chip oscillator for ultra-compact, low-cost control tasks. Suitable for appliance timers, simple sensor monitors, and low-complexity consumer electronics.

ACTIVEIntegrated CircuitVerified Jun 2026
Package / Visual Reference
PIC12C508A-04/PDual-In-Line Packages
Quick Facts
Manufacturer
Microchip
Package
Dual-In-Line Packages
Pin Count
8
Lifecycle
ACTIVE
Category
Integrated Circuit
Price
From $1.2746(MOQ 1)
Temp Range
?°C to 70.0°C
RoHS
Compliant
Lead Time
3–7 business days
Shipping
DHL Express · Worldwide

Key Features

  • 8-bit PIC12 CPU running up to 4 MHz
  • 512 x 12-bit words of OTP program memory
  • 25 bytes of on-chip SRAM for runtime data
  • 6 general-purpose I/O pins in a minimal 8-pin DIP package
  • Internal 4 MHz RC oscillator eliminates external crystal
  • Low-power CMOS design for battery-operated applications

Applications

The PIC12C508A-04/P is ideal for ultra-small embedded control tasks such as appliance timers, LED flashers, motor soft-start controllers, and remote control decoders where code size fits within 512 words. Its 8-pin DIP body is inexpensive and easy to prototype on a breadboard, making it a favourite for high-volume, cost-sensitive consumer products. The internal RC oscillator removes the need for an external clock component, further reducing BOM cost and PCB area.

Specifications

Pbfree CodeYes
Manufacturer Package CodePDIP-8
Factory Lead Time8Weeks
Date Of Intro1996-05-10
YTEOL3
Has ADCNO
Bit Size8
Boundary ScanNO
CPU FamilyPIC12
Clock Frequency-Max4MHz
DAC ChannelsNO
DMA ChannelsNO
FormatFIXED POINT
Integrated CacheNO
JESD-30 CodeR-PDIP-T8
JESD-609 Codee3
Low Power ModeYES
Number of I/O Lines6
Number of Timers2
On Chip Data RAM Width8
On Chip Program ROM Width12
PWM ChannelsNO
Package Body MaterialPLASTIC/EPOXY
Package Equivalence CodeDIP8,.3
Package ShapeRECTANGULAR
Package StyleIN-LINE
Qualification StatusNot Qualified
RAM (bytes)25
ROM (words)512
ROM ProgrammabilityOTPROM
Speed4MHz
Supply Current-Max1.4mA
Supply Voltage-Max5.5V
Supply Voltage-Min5V
Supply Voltage-Nom5V
Surface MountNO
TechnologyCMOS
Temperature GradeCOMMERCIAL
Terminal FinishMatte Tin (Sn)
Terminal FormTHROUGH-HOLE
Terminal Pitch2.54mm
Terminal PositionDUAL
uPs/uCs/Peripheral ICs TypeMICROCONTROLLER, RISC
PackageDual-In-Line Packages

Compliance & Regulatory

RoHS StatusCompliant
Lead-FreeYes (Pb-Free)
ECCNEAR99
HTS Code8542.31.00.01
Country of OriginThailand

Datasheet

PIC12C508A-04/P Datasheet Download

Official datasheet from Microchip

Alternate & Equivalent Parts

Compatible alternatives and drop-in replacements for PIC12C508A-04/P:

PIC12C508A-04I/PMicrochip Technology Inc

MCU CMOS 8LD .5K EPRM

View Part →
PIC12C509A-04/PMicrochip Technology Inc

MCU CMOS 8LD 1K EPRM

View Part →
PIC12C509A-04I/PMicrochip Technology Inc

RISC Microcontroller, 8-Bit, OTPROM, PIC12 CPU, 4MHz, CMOS, PDIP8

View Part →
PIC12C508-04I/PMicrochip Technology Inc

RISC Microcontroller, 8-Bit, OTPROM, PIC12 CPU, 4MHz, CMOS, PDIP8

View Part →

Frequently Asked Questions

How much program memory does the PIC12C508A-04/P have, and what type of memory is it?

The PIC12C508A-04/P uses 512 words of OTP (one-time programmable) memory with a 12-bit instruction width. OTP memory is programmed once during manufacturing or production testing and cannot be erased, which makes it appropriate for locked, high-volume production firmware but unsuitable for development iterations where code changes are expected.

Does the PIC12C508A-04/P require an external crystal, and what clock options are available?

No external crystal is needed. The device includes an internal 4 MHz RC oscillator that is enabled by configuration bits, allowing operation with no external clock components. This reduces the 8-pin DIP BOM to the MCU plus supply decoupling capacitors, which is the minimum possible component count for a standalone microcontroller circuit.

When should a designer choose the PIC12C508A-04/P over the PIC12F508 with Flash memory?

The PIC12C508A-04/P with OTP memory suits locked production runs where firmware is finalized and cost per unit must be minimized, since OTP devices are typically cheaper than Flash variants. The PIC12F508, which is pin-compatible with the same 8-pin DIP footprint and 4 MHz speed, is the better choice during development and for programs requiring field reprogramming, because its Flash memory supports unlimited erase and reprogram cycles.

Why Buy from FindMyChip

Authorized Source
Verified supply chain with full traceability & inspection
$
Competitive Pricing
Factory-direct from China distributors, low MOQ
Fast Shipping
DHL Express 3–5 days · FedEx/UPS 5–7 days worldwide
Quality Guaranteed
30-day replacement for defective parts, no questions asked

About Microchip

Microchip is a leading electronic component manufacturer. FindMyChip sources Microchip ICs directly from authorized China distributors, offering competitive pricing and reliable stock.

AvailabilityIn Stock
Reference Price (USD)
From $1.2746
Buy from 1pc · Factory-direct pricing
Qty.Unit PriceExt. Price
1+$1.4200$1.42
2+$1.2746$2.55
pcs
Unit price: $1.4200 · Total: $1.42

In Stock · 24h Response · Worldwide Shipping

Lead Time3-7 business days
MOQFrom 1 piece
ShippingDHL / FedEx / UPS
OriginChina (Authorized)

Response within 24 hours · Worldwide shipping

FindMyChip sourced our entire STM32 BOM in 48 hours when our usual distributor had 16-week lead times.

TM
Thomas Mueller
Hardware Lead, SensorTech GmbH, Germany